# Is "The Autograph Man" by Zadie Smith a First Edition?

> **Quick answer.** A first edition of The Autograph Man by Zadie Smith (Hamish Hamilton, 2002) is identified by: The UK first edition is bound in black paper-covered boards with gilt spine lettering and red endpapers, with a full number line counting down to 1 on the copyright page. The UK Hamish Hamilton edition (September 2002) is the true first, preceding the US Random House edition (published October 2002), which is distinguished by its light-blue-stamped white paper-covered boards.

## Is this the true first?
The UK Hamish Hamilton edition (September 2002) is the true first, preceding the US Random House edition (published October 2002), which is distinguished by its light-blue-stamped white paper-covered boards.

## Telling it from reprints & book-club editions
Later impressions state the impression number on the copyright page; the true first shows the complete descending number line.
